Welcome
Knowsley's Children's Services City Learning Centres have been established under the Excellence in Cities initiative, to be Centres of excellence for the use of ICT in learning and teaching. They work with a number of partners to develop as national centres of excellence for the use of ICT, performing arts, media, sports and healthy living.
The CLCs a challenging learning environments. They are an integral part of Knowsley's ICT strategy which is at the heart of an innovative approach to raising standards.

Plus One Challenge
The Knowsley Plus One Challenge is an initiative developed in partnership with schools to enhance and extend current school practice. It challenges every current Year 11 pupil to raise their predicted grades by one in at least one subject between mock exams and the GCSEs in the summer.
